2015 Prima Baby Award Silver, UK 2014 Junior Design Award Highly Commended, UK 2014 Prima Baby Award Shortlisted, UK 2013 Parents A Choisi Award Winner, France 2013 Natural Child World Eco-Excellence Award Finalist, US 2012/2013 Practical Parenting & Pregnancy Award Gold, UK 2011/2012 Practical Parenting & Pregnancy Award Finalist, UK 2011 Loved By Parents Gold, UK 2010 Belgium Baby Innovation Award, Belgium 2010 Practical Pre-school Award Silver, UKBaby high chairs found in restaurants have been found to harbour more bacteria than the average public toilet seat.Teams took swabs from high chairs in 30 different restaurants and found that on average the number of bacteria on a high chair – including some which can lead to serious illness - was 147 per square centimetre. By comparison the average public toilet seat has just eight per square centimetre.The bacteria found included E-coli. Staph aureus and enterococcus faecalis which can cause upset stomachs - a serious illness for young children.

Research has found they harbour more bacteria than the average public toilet seat Parents are now being warned to ensure that the high chairs are cleaned before use because of the risk that their child could become ill as a result of the germs lucking there. Dr Nicholas Moon director of technical affairs at Microban, makers of antibacterial products, which conducted the research across a variety of restaurants, said: 'The test results varied considerably and while some of the high chairs were relatively clean, others had concentrations of bacteria as high as 1,200 bacteria per square centimetre, which is worrying. 'This is of concern because a child’s immune system tends to be far less robust than an adult's and children tend to touch things and put their hands in their mouth a lot – so they easily infect themselves with any germs they encounter.




'Small children are, of course, often messy with food and as a consequence much of it goes on tables and chairs. 'However, as many parents will vouch, it is far from unusual to be presented with a high chair for use that is covered in smears and other food stains from earlier use. 'Sometimes these stains may have been there for days – and that is just the visible evidence of a lack of attention to cleanliness. 'However the report found high levels of bacteria even on high chairs that looked clean to the visible eye - indicating that even when staff clear obvious spillages they are not using antibacterial spray cleaners to ensure that the chair is thoroughly cleaned before the next child sits down.'This lack of attention could easily lead to cross-contamination or more serious illnesses. Making a mess: Children are messy so parents must ensure that high chairs are cleaned thoroughly before use 'While this research was conducted in the USA I would suspect that the high chairs in restaurants in this country would if anything be even dirtier as we tend to be less thorough about our hygiene than the Americans.'Restaurants are now being urged to improve their standards of cleanliness.
